About London Borough of Lambeth
Lambeth, a vibrant borough in Central London, is part of Inner London and has a rich history, with its name first recorded in 1062. The borough features the geographical centre of London at Frazier Street, close to Lambeth North tube station, while the nearby Charing Cross is traditionally regarded as the city's focal point. Conservation Areas
There are 62 designated conservation areas within the London Borough of Lambeth area. Planning applications within or near these areas are subject to additional scrutiny to preserve architectural and historic character. Permitted development rights may be restricted.
Conservation areas include: Wandsworth Road, Albert Square, Abbeville Road, Lansdowne Gardens, Oaklands Estate, Renfrew Road, Gipsy Hill, South Lambeth Road, The Chase, Roupell Street, and 52 more.

Planning Activity
In the last 24 months, 1,714 planning applications London Borough of Lambeth received. Of these, 80% were approved, with an average decision time of 61 days.
This is below the national average of approximately 87%, which may reflect stricter local policies, sensitivity of the area, or higher levels of speculative applications. Pre-application advice is particularly worthwhile in London Borough of Lambeth.
At 61 days on average, decisions in London Borough of Lambeth slightly exceed the 8-week statutory target for minor applications, though this is common across many councils.
The most common application types in London Borough of Lambeth were discharge of conditions (402), outline applications (264), tree works (208).
In terms of development scale, 51 large-scale (major) developments, 56 medium-scale applications, 1,229 smaller schemes were submitted. The high volume of major applications indicates significant development pressure in the area, which may interest property developers and investors.
